Col de Tsanfleuron
Col de Tsanfleuron is a mountain saddle in Ormont-Dessus, Aigle District, Vaud and has an elevation of 2,821 metres. Col de Tsanfleuron is situated nearby to the locality Quille du diable, as well as near Sentier des Prés Jordan.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Oldenhorn
Peak
Photo: Xperience, Public domain.
The Oldenhorn is a mountain in the western Bernese Alps in Switzerland. The summit is the tripoint between the cantons of Vaud, Bern and Valais. The Oldenhorn is the second highest peak of the massif of the Diablerets and canton of Vaud.
Scex Rouge
Scenic viewpoint
Photo: Zacharie Grossen, CC BY-SA 4.0.
The Scex Rouge is a mountain of the Alps, overlooking Les Diablerets in the canton of Vaud. Along with the Oldenhorn to the east, it is one of the main peaks of the Diablerets, a huge ice-covered mountain near the western end of the Bernese Alps, straddling the border between the cantons of Vaud, Valais, and Bern, and exceeding 3,000 metres above sea level.
Tsanfleuron Glacier
Glacier
Photo: Jeremy.toma, CC BY-SA 4.0.
The Tsanfleuron Glacier is a 3.5 km long glacier situated in the western Bernese Alps in the cantons of Valais and Vaud in Switzerland. In 1973 it had an area of 3.81 km2.

Derborence
Hamlet
Photo: Clare66,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Derborence is a hamlet in the municipality of Conthey, in the canton of Valais, in Switzerland. It is located at 1,450 metres in an isolated valley on the south side of the Bernese Alps and is not permanently inhabited.
Les Diablerets
Photo: Zacharie Grossen,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Les Diablerets is a ski resort in Vaud in Switzerland. It has high-altitude skiing on the glacier and some challenging runs. It's connected by ski-lifts to nearby Villars-sur-Ollon, which is at lower altitude and better suited to young children and beginners.
